Wholly aromatic polyesters based on isophthalic acid, terephthalic acid, p-hydroxybenzoic acid, hydroquinone and an arylene diol, e.g. 4,4'-biphenol are described. The materials displayed are excellent overall combination of mechanical and thermal properties. Their melting points and heat distortion temperatures (264 psi) are at least about 260 DEG C. and 260 DEG C., respectively. These novel polymers can be melt-fabricated using standard injection molding, extrusion, and melt spinning techniques and yield fabricated articles with good surface characteristics.
